Jessica Ferguson shares the deeply personal story of her brother's struggle with serious mental illness and how systemic failures led to his incarceration after being accused of a triple homicide when he should have been in psychiatric care.

• Her brother had been stable with his mental illness for a decade before showing concerning behavior changes in early 2023
• Despite three psychiatric hospitalizations within months, he was repeatedly discharged after 72-hour holds with no substantial care plan
• Family pleas for help were ignored as healthcare providers cited voluntary treatment requirements and HIPAA restrictions
• Only after being accused of a crime did he receive consistent psychiatric care
• The jail system provides minimal mental health support compared to psychiatric hospitals
• Families need healthcare proxy arrangements and better knowledge of resources before crises occur
• Massachusetts lacks Assisted Outpatient Treatment (AOT) options that could mandate treatment
• Mental health systems must partner with families who know their loved ones best
